BMW F22 2 Series

Generally as the substitution for the 3 arrangement car has turned into the 4 arrangement, the new era of 1 arrangement roadster is presently known as the 2 arrangement. BMW has declared the details and estimating of the 220i Coupé, 220d Coupé and the M235i Coupé, with deals to begin in Germany in November 2013, and in different markets in the meantime or quickly from that point.

The new 2 arrangement is marginally bigger than the friendly 1 arrangement roadster that it replaces, having picked up 30 mm in the wheelbase, now at 2690 mm, and 72 mm long to 4432 mm. On a model by model premise, the kerb weight remains essentially indistinguishable, going from 1425 kg (EU) for the manual gearbox 220i to 1545 kg for the programmed transmission form of the M235i Coupé.

The BMW 220i Coupé has a turbocharged 4 pot delivering 184 PS (181 bhp, 135 kw) of force and torque of 270 N·m (199 lb·ft, 27.5 kg·m) at 1250-4500 rpm. Furnished with a six pace manual movement transmission, the guaranteed 0-100 km/h time is 7.0 seconds, and Co2 discharges are 142 g/km. With the eight velocity programmed alternative box ticked, those figures are 7.0 seconds and 134 g/km separately.

The BMW 220d Coupé is the sole diesel form accessible at dispatch. It has a 2 liter 4 barrel basic rail diesel motor that creates 184 PS (181 bhp, 135 kw) of force and 380 N·m (280 lb·ft, 38.8 kg·m) of torque at 1750-2750 rpm. It excessively is accessible with either a six rate manual or eight velocity programmed 'box, and the 0-100 km/h times and Co2 emanations are 7.2 seconds and 119 g/km separately for the manual adaptation, and 7.1 seconds and 111 g/km for the programmed.

The most effective 2 arrangement roadster will be the BMW M235i Coupé, with the same turbocharged 3 liter 6 barrel powerplant found in the M135i hatchback. This motor creates 326 PS (322 bhp, 240 kw) of force and 450 N·m (332 lb·ft, 45.9 kg·m) of torque from 1300 rpm to 4500 rpm. This empowers the manual M235i to blanket the benchmark sprint to 100 km/h in 5.0 seconds, the standing kilometer in 23.8 seconds, and on to a top speed electronically constrained to 250 km/h. Co2 figures are 189 g/km. The programmed adaptation of the M235i is asserted to be marginally speedier still, with the 100 km/h sprint secured in a sparse 4,8 seconds, the standing kilometer dispatched in 23.7 seconds and the top speed additionally constrained to 250 km/h. Guaranteed Co2 emanations are 176 g/km for the eight pace programmed.

The starting lineup is liable to be supplemented by more petrol and diesel variations, and also select models with BMW's xdrive .
